iPhone 5

NEW YORK  -- "iPhone 5" is trending Thursday as rumors swirl about the look and feel of the new phone when it arrives this September.


Apple's newest iPhone will feature a new processor, the same powerful chip included in the iPad 2, an updated camera and possibly an all-new look. The iPhone 5 could be curvier and slimmer than its prior versions, according to some reports.
Since the smartphone's debut, Apple has launched a new iPhone every June.
Another popular search on the Internet Thursday includes "Saab" after news that the carmaker is so strapped for cash it can't pay wages to its employees.
Saab said it hasn't obtained necessary short-term funding to pay its workers. In response, two Saab unions have demanded payment by Monday, or they'll take legal action that could result in the company being put into bankruptcy.
Saab's production was halted for most of April, May and June because it could not pay suppliers, and now also needs funds to restart it. The company agreed to a rescue package earlier this month from two Chinese companies, pending approval from the Chinese and Swedish governments, the European Investment Bank and shareholder General Motors. In the deal, Saab would hand over a majority stake in return for a cash injection that could potentially solve longer-term financial problems.

Belfast riots renew calls for Protestant-Catholic dialogue  

Posted by news , hot uk offers , google reader


Dublin, Ireland – Rioting engulfed the Short Strand district of Belfast, Northern Ireland, Tuesday night, as pro-British loyalists and Irish republican residents of the area clashed for the second consecutive day.
Local police said that as many as 400 people participated in the violence and that a news photographer was wounded in a shooting in one of Belfast's most tense neighborhoods. In an effort to break up the fights, police fired at least 66 plastic bullets but made only one arrest: a young woman was detained on suspicion of possession of a firearm and assaulting police.
While police and locals blamed the loyalist Ulster Volunteer Force (UVF) for sparking the violence on Monday and being involved in fighting last night, an unnamed dissident republican splinter group may be equally to blame in Tuesday's melee.

The violence has already led to calls for renewed dialogue between Protestant and Catholic groups, especially as it becomes evident that splinter paramilitary groups are trying to revive discord along political and religious lines.
“In the past there, we had an interface group where Short Strand community leaders would call me or someone else [and vice versa] if there was trouble brewing. I think there was a feeling from Sinn Féin that it was a policing responsibility – and I can see their point – but now we, on both sides of the community, want to see those structures reestablished. Similar initiatives are going on to resolve issues in other parts of Belfast," says Sammy Douglas, a local lawmaker with the pro-British Democratic Unionist Party (DUP) who has worked as a community activist in east Belfast.
Marching season nearsMany local leaders say the spike in sectarian violence – coupled with the increasingly murky picture of which groups are involved – is especially troubling as Northern Ireland's always-tense "marching season" approaches.

During the marching season, which reaches its high point on July 12 but continues until the end of August, the Protestant Orange Institution and associated groups – including bands named after loyalist paramilitary organizations – parade throughout Northern Ireland.
The parades, which republicans view as provocative displays of sectarianism but unionists see as expressions of British identity, have often ended in violence.
The paramilitary playersSo far, there is no indication that the mainstream Provisional IRA (PIRA) has engaged in the fighting. The Independent International Commission on Decommissioning (IICD) confirmed the PIRA had disarmed by September 2005. Dissident groups formed by disaffected members of the PIRA and who remain committed to war include the Continuity IRA, founded in 1987 and the Real IRA, formed in 1997. A third group was formed from a split within the Real IRA in 2009, calling itself Óglaigh na hÉireann (the Gaelic name traditionally used by the various IRAs).
In the past two years, dissident republicans have killed two policemen and two British soldiers, the most recent killing being the car bombing of police officer Ronan Kerr in April 2011. Both groups have staged dozens of other actions including so-called "punishment shooting" vigilante actions against criminals and several failed bomb and gun attacks.
On the loyalist side of the conflict, matters are more confused. The UVF and the Ulster Defence Association were supposedly disarmed and disbanded.
But the IMC’s most recent report, issued in March, said the UVF was still active: “Notwithstanding the progress made in the past three years, the organization’s role in the murder of [member] Bobby Moffett calls into question the claim in the May 2007 statement that the UVF would become a civilian organization. We do not doubt the wish of the leadership to pursue the 2007 strategy though there are some within the organization who are evidently not ready to accept the restraints on their behavior which this means.”
Now, the UVF’s role in leading the recent riots suggests a power struggle within the paramilitary group.
A Protestant and unionist resident of east Belfast, who did not wish to be identified, said whatever progress was being made between republicans and unionists in high office needed to be replicated on the ground. “Neither the dissidents nor the UVF speak for the people. People were led into a false sense of security, thinking the weapons had gone away."

Stress in the City: Brain Activity and Biology Behind Mood Disorders of Urbanites  

Posted by news , hot uk offers , google reader

(June 22, 2011) — Being born and raised in a major urban area is associated with greater

 lifetime risk for anxiety and mood disorders. Until now, the biology for these associations had not been described. A new international study, which involved Douglas Mental Health University Institute researcher Jens Pruessner, is the first to show that two distinct brain regions that regulate emotion and stress are affected by city living. These findings, published in Nature may lead to strategies that improve the quality of life for city dwellers.

"Previous findings have shown that the risk for anxiety disorders is 21 percent higher for people from the city, who also have a 39 percent increase for mood disorders," says co-author Jens Pruessner, a Douglas researcher. "In addition, the incidence for schizophrenia is almost doubled for individuals who are born and brought up in cities. These values are a cause for concern and determining the biology behind this is the first step to remedy the trend."
Distinct brain structures
Pruessner, with his colleagues from the Central Institute of Mental Health in Mannheim, looked at the brain activity of healthy volunteers from urban and rural areas. In a series of functional magnetic resonance experiments involving the Douglas' previously developed 'Montreal Imaging Stress Task',(MIST) protocol, they showed that city living was associated with greater stress responses in the amygdala, an area of the brain involved with emotional regulation and mood. In contrast, urban upbringing was found to be associated with activity in the cingulate cortex, a region involved in regulation of negative affect and stress.
"These findings suggest that different brain regions are sensitive to the experience of city living during different times across the lifespan," says Pruessner. "Future studies need to clarify the link between psychopathology and these affects in individuals with mental disorders.These findings contribute to our understanding of urban environmental risk for mental disorders and health in general. They further point to a new approach to interface social sciences, neurosciences and public policy to respond to the major health challenge of urbanization."

It happens all the time: Casual fans think Miss America and Miss U.S.A. are one in the same.
I'll set the record straight: They're not even close.
Yes, it's true, in both competitions beautiful young women are awarded tiaras, a title, roses and scholarships. And they are judged in evening gown and swimsuit attire, and they answer tough questions in front of a panel of judges.
But Sunday night's Miss U.S.A. competition., which was won by Miss California Alyssa Campanella, is the Donald Trump-owned pageant that is best known for creating controversies.
Anyone remember Miss U.S.A. Tara Connor from 2006, who entered rehab because of reported drug and alcohol problems. (Trump allowed her to maintain her title.)
And Miss California Carrie Prejean received national attention in 2009 when she told judge/blogger Perez Hilton that marriage should be between a man and a woman. She was first runner-up.
Even the outgoing Miss U.S.A. Rima Fakih made her missteps and found herself defending her actions. Shortly after winning her crown, a video surfaced of her competing in a stripper pole contest. And more recently she was investigated for excessive partying and missing interviews.
The former Miss Michigan said she has learned a lot from the experience.
"I think I've grown so much this year. I'm proud to say that I am giving up my crown on June 19 and I still have the crown," Fakih told "Good Morning America's" Robin Roberts.
Miss U.S.A., which debuted in 1952, is a qualifier for Miss Universe.
As for Miss America, this is the show we all know and love from Bert Parks days. It debuted in 1921 and now is best known for its scholarships.
On Saturday, a new Miss Michigan was crowned (Elizabeth Wertenberger). She will represent the Great Lakes State at Miss America.
The last Miss Michigan to win the crown was Kirsten Haglund in 2008. Amway is a major sponsor of the contest and regularly brings Miss America to the Grand Rapids area.
As for the differences, here is what Miss America posts as an FAQ on its website:
Is the Miss America program different than Miss USA?
Yes. In 1952, Catalina Swimsuits founded the Miss USA and Miss Universe pageants as product promotion tools. Developed by the Miss America Organization, the Miss America program exists to provide personal and professional opportunities for young women to promote their voices in culture, politics and the community. Almost all contestants have either received, or are in the process of earning college or postgraduate degrees and utilize Miss America scholarship grants to further their educations. The Miss America Organization is the leading provider of scholarships for young women in the world. Although some young women compete in both Miss America and Miss USA, the two systems are completely separate

Ryan Dunn, 'Jackass' star, dead at 34  

Posted by news , hot uk offers , google reader


Ryan Dunn, whose crazy stunts were chronicled on MTV’s extreme series “Jackass,” died in a car accident early Monday morning near his home in Pennsylvania. He was 34.
"We're deeply saddened by the passing of a member of the MTV family, Ryan Dunn," MTV tweeted on Monday morning. "Our hearts and thoughts are with his friends and family."
According to the West Goshen Police Department, Dunn's 2007 Porsche 911 GT3 went off the road in West Goshen and was in flames.  An unidentified passenger was also in the car. Dunn and the passenger died around 3 a.m. as a result of their injuries from accident. Excessive speed may have a contributing factor in the accident, police said.
On Monday morning, Johnny Knoxville, the head of the “Jackass” clan, tweeted: “Today I lost my brother Ryan Dunn. My heart goes out to his family and his beloved Angie. RIP Ryan, I love you buddy.”
"Jackass' " Jason "Weeman" Acuña tweeted Monday of Dunn: "I MISS YOU BUD!! You were always a happy kick-ass dude!!"
Dunn appeared in all three "Jackass" films and even ventured outside the wild antics in projects including NBC’s "Law & Order: SVU" and the straight-to-DVD film "Blonde Ambition," starring Jessica Simpson.
